1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the purpose of explaining your evidence in an informational essay?

Back

To show how the evidence fits in with the topic.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the first sentence of a body paragraph called?

Back

The topic sentence.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a concluding sentence?

Back

A sentence that you put at the end of your body paragraph to wrap it up, and to connect it to your thesis.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does a topic sentence do?

Back

It is the first sentence of a paragraph that tells what the paragraph will be about.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What should you do at the beginning of a paragraph?

Back

Indent.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the main function of a body paragraph in an informational essay?

Back

To provide evidence and explanations that support the thesis.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How many sentences should a body paragraph typically contain?

Back

At least 5-7 sentences.
